Cytosorbents Corporation reported a Q1 2026 EPS of -$0.08, falling short of the consensus estimate of -$0.0561 by 42.6%. Revenue figures were not disclosed for the quarter. Despite the earnings miss, the stock rose 0.22% following the announcement, suggesting investors may be focusing on longer-term prospects rather than the immediate bottom-line disappointment.

During Q1 2026, Cytosorbents continued to advance its core hemoperfusion technology platform, which is primarily used for blood purification in critical care settings. The reported EPS loss of $0.08 reflects ongoing investment in research and development, sales expansion, and regulatory activities. While revenue was not provided, the company’s focus remains on gaining commercial traction for its CytoSorb device in sepsis, COVID-19, and cardiac surgery indications. Operating expenses likely remained elevated due to clinical trial costs and commercialization efforts in key international markets, particularly Europe and select Asian regions. The company also faces competitive pressures from alternative blood purification technologies. The absence of a revenue figure may indicate that top-line growth has not yet reached a level deemed reportable by management, or that the company is still in a pre-revenue or low-revenue stage. Margin trends are not available, but the negative EPS underscores the cash-intensive nature of medical device commercialization and the need for future product approvals or partnerships to drive profitability. Management did not provide explicit forward guidance for the remainder of fiscal year 2026. However, based on the company’s strategic roadmap, Cytosorbents anticipates continued investment in regulatory submissions for additional indications, including potential U.S. FDA clearance for CytoSorb in certain applications. The company may also pursue expanded reimbursement coverage in international markets to improve hospital adoption rates. Key risk factors include the timing of regulatory approvals, which could be delayed, and the need for additional capital raises to fund operations, as the current cash burn rate may require financing within the next few quarters. The company’s reliance on its single product platform introduces concentration risk, though ongoing clinical studies for new use cases could diversify revenue sources. Management expects to provide updates on pivotal trial results and commercial partnerships later in the year. Investors should monitor cash position and any announcements regarding distribution agreements in larger markets such as the United States. Despite the significant EPS miss, the stock’s modest uptick of 0.22% suggests that some market participants may have already priced in a weak quarter or are focusing on future catalysts. Analyst coverage on Cytosorbents is limited, but those who follow the stock will likely revise near-term estimates downward following the Q1 results. The lack of revenue disclosure raises questions about the company’s ability to generate meaningful sales from its existing commercial footprint. Investment implications are cautious: while the technology addresses a genuine clinical need in critical care, the path to profitability remains uncertain. Key items to watch include the next quarterly filing for detailed revenue breakdown, updates on FDA submission status, any new partnership announcements, and changes in cash burn rate.
